Delete a Text Box
Reader rating: 5 out of 10
Introduction
Text boxes can be valuable tools when lining up text in your documents. When you no longer need a text box, you can quickly and easily delete it.
Delete a Text Box
1. Click the frame of the text box you would like to delete.
2. The frame will be highlighted (a medium size border will appear around the text box).
3. Press the delete key on your keyboard.
4. The text box will now be deleted.
